Foot and ankle surgeons, recognized by several state medical boards as a fellowship subspecialty of orthopaedic surgery, specialize in adult reconstructive foot and ankle surgery, management of adult foot and ankle trauma, sports medicine related to the foot and ankle, and reconstructive surgery for childrens foot and ankle conditions.
